Description
1,3,5-Triazin-2-Amine,1,4,5,6-Tetrahydro-(9Ci) is a specialized heterocyclic amine compound with the CAS number 67458-80-4, serving as a versatile building block in advanced organic synthesis. Its saturated triazine core structure makes it a valuable intermediate for creating complex molecules with tailored properties. This chemical is essential for research and development chemists in the pharmaceutical and agrochemical industries, where it is used to develop new active ingredients and functional materials.
Application
- Pharmaceutical Intermediate: Key precursor in the synthesis of novel drug candidates, particularly those targeting central nervous system (CNS) disorders or possessing antiviral activity.
- Agrochemical Synthesis: Building block for developing new herbicides, fungicides, and plant growth regulators with enhanced efficacy and selectivity.
- Material Science Research: Used in the development of specialty polymers, resins, and ligands for metal-organic frameworks (MOFs) due to its nitrogen-rich structure.
- Dye and Pigment Manufacturing: Intermediate for creating heterocyclic dyes and colorants with improved lightfastness and thermal stability.
- Academic & Industrial R&D: Fundamental reagent in methodological studies and process chemistry for constructing complex nitrogen-containing heterocycles.
Basic Information
| Product Name | 1,3,5-Triazin-2-Amine,1,4,5,6-Tetrahydro-(9Ci) |
| CAS No. | 67458-80-4 |
| Molecular Formula | C3H7N5 |
| Molecular Weight | 113.12 g/mol |
| Synonyms | 1,4,5,6-Tetrahydro-1,3,5-triazin-2-amine; 2-Amino-1,4,5,6-tetrahydro-1,3,5-triazine; 1,3,5-Triazin-2-amine, 1,4,5,6-tetrahydro-; Tetrahydro-1,3,5-triazin-2-amine; Aminotetrahydrotriazine; 1,3,5-Triazine-2-amine, 1,4,5,6-tetrahydro- (9CI); 67458-80-4; NSC 403058 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from strong oxidizing agents. For long-term storage, consider an inert atmosphere to maintain optimal stability.
